Definition:
flatter
- flatterGive an unrealistically favorable impression of
- flatterLavish insincere praise and compliments upon (someone), esp. to further one's own interests
- flatterPlease (the ear or eye)
- flatterMake (someone) feel honored and pleased
- flatterto praise excessively
- flatterMake oneself feel pleased by believing something favorable about oneself, typically something that is unfounded
- flatter(of a color or a style of clothing) Make (someone) appear more attractive or to the best advantage
